Runbook — Transcode farm release (Milldusk cluster)

1. Freeze the job queue; drain in-flight transcodes, max 40 min.
2. Snapshot the preset store.
3. Roll worker image to the tagged build, one rack at a time.
4. Run the smoke reel: 4K HDR, interlaced legacy, and the 10-second edge clip. All three must match golden checksums.
5. Unfreeze queue; watch error rate 30 min.

Rollback: re-pin previous image, replay snapshot. Workers refuse unsigned images, so push the build signed with the key below.

release key, hadug-kawef: bky13_mPGeFZeR1GZ1G

### Runbook: ReceiptRelay mailer stuck

Symptoms: donation receipts queueing, no sends, queue depth alert fires.

First: check the SMTP relay health endpoint. If healthy, the mailer worker is probably wedged on a malformed template — restart the worker pool, not the whole service. If unhealthy, fail over to the secondary relay and page the infra rotation. Do not replay the dead-letter queue until dedupe is confirmed on, or donors get duplicate receipts. Verify the service is running with the following configuration values.

config for kajeg-bafop:
[julael]
host = julael.plorvadata.corp
user = julael_svc
database = julael_prod

Onboarding for reviewers — Tillgate payments. When reviewing retry logic, confirm the idempotency key is generated client-side before the first request and persisted with the order record. Any code that mints a new key inside a retry loop should be rejected. Keys are scoped per merchant in the Brindle ledger and expire after 72 hours; check that TTL handling matches. Our test harness replays duplicate requests automatically, so run it on every PR. The harness credentials vault opens with the recovery passphrase that follows.

vault phrase of fahog-yajog = frawyn-jordor-casael-gormir-olieth-julmir

// SEAT_GRID_CELL_PX controls the base cell size for the Veldane Playhouse
// seat-map renderer. Raising it above 18 breaks the balcony rows because
// the curvature transform assumes cells fit within the arc segment width.
// We discussed this at the last eng sync: do not "fix" overlap by scaling
// the SVG viewBox; adjust row spacing constants instead. Accessibility
// seats render with a wider cell and ignore this value entirely.
// The renderer build that validated these numbers is noted below.

pipeline stamp: htk31_f769b577b3028a4e9958e5bb8d1259a